Transaction 19b6c31109523700fa81d626a2e49bdc504f2789a375348680ecce0119868a48

1 Input
2 Outputs
  • 19b6c31109523700fa81d626a2e49bdc504f2789a375348680ecce0119868a48:0
  • value  508593
    address  2NFzh71qE61LjeRtMM3RyDxXCz41Cbj4XHk
  • 19b6c31109523700fa81d626a2e49bdc504f2789a375348680ecce0119868a48:1
  • value  1258139
    address  2MwnpbsmAagD1FhiidSCfRtpzih6kTsgH7s